Transaction 34285ac01c2cd19bc32449a4eac72a0f60dac14d81e25a00db3740d33ee5b0d6

4 Input
1 Outputs
  • 34285ac01c2cd19bc32449a4eac72a0f60dac14d81e25a00db3740d33ee5b0d6:0
  • value  8813250
    address  1CYA6TEP5jQZPvAKmsYA46UGMjmd8XZYaj